Imperva Research Labs analyzed more than 100 of the biggest data breaches and found that 75.9% of stolen data was PII.Read More
via VentureBeat
Imperva Research Labs analyzed more than 100 of the biggest data breaches and found that 75.9% of stolen data was PII.Read More
via VentureBeat